基于渗滤效应的砂层盾构隧道环外注浆渗透扩散模型研究

摘  要:为探究已建盾构隧道在卸压排水条件下的环外注浆渗透扩散规律,根据渗滤效应下浆液渗透扩散路径方程,通过对环外注浆正、负压空间分布的计算,建立了考虑渗滤效应的卸压排水环外半球形渗透扩散理论模型,给出了浆液渗透扩散半径理论表达式,结合相关试验结果进行验证,并分析注浆压力、渗滤系数、注入速率及卸压孔距离对浆液渗透扩散范围的影响。结果表明:(1)考虑渗滤效应的盾构隧道环外注浆渗透扩散模型可较好地描述浆液渗透扩散的空间分布规律;(2)环外注浆渗透扩散半径与注浆压力呈正相关关系,与渗滤系数呈负相关关系,而与浆液注入速率和卸压孔距离无关;(3)环外注浆扩散半径随着注浆时间推移逐渐增大并最终趋于稳定,最佳注浆时间为30~60 min,并且可以通过增大泄水压力进一步提升浆液的渗透扩散范围。In order to explore the seepage and diffusion law of grouting outside the ring under the condition of pressure relief and drainage in the existing shield tunnel,according to the path equation of slurry seepage and diffusion under the seepage effect,the theoretical model of hemispherical seepage and diffusion outside the ring considering the seepage effect is established by calculating the spatial distribution of positive and negative pressure of grouting outside the ring,and the theoretical expression of slurry seepage and diffusion radius is given.Combined with the relevant test results,the influence of grouting pressure,infiltration coefficient,injection rate and distance of pressure relief hole on the range of slurry seepage and diffusion is analyzed.The results show that:(1)The seepage diffusion model of grouting outside the ring of shield tunnel considering seepage effect can better describe the spatial distribution law of slurry seepage diffusion.(2)The seepage diffusion radius of grouting outside the ring is positively correlated with the grouting pressure,and the infiltration coefficient is negatively correlated,but independent of the slurry injection rate and the distance of the pressure relief hole.(3)The diffusion radius of grouting outside the ring gradually increases with the grouting time and finally tends to be stable.The optimal grouting time is 30-60 min,and the seepage diffusion range of the slurry can be further improved by increasing the discharge pressure.
